Home | History | Annotate | Download | only in x509
      1 
      2 package org.bouncycastle.asn1.x509;
      3 
      4 import org.bouncycastle.asn1.ASN1ObjectIdentifier;
      5 
      6 /**
      7  * PolicyQualifierId, used in the CertificatePolicies
      8  * X509V3 extension.
      9  *
     10  * <pre>
     11  *    id-qt          OBJECT IDENTIFIER ::=  { id-pkix 2 }
     12  *    id-qt-cps      OBJECT IDENTIFIER ::=  { id-qt 1 }
     13  *    id-qt-unotice  OBJECT IDENTIFIER ::=  { id-qt 2 }
     14  *  PolicyQualifierId ::=
     15  *       OBJECT IDENTIFIER (id-qt-cps | id-qt-unotice)
     16  * </pre>
     17  */
     18 public class PolicyQualifierId extends ASN1ObjectIdentifier
     19 {
     20    private static final String id_qt = "1.3.6.1.5.5.7.2";
     21 
     22    private PolicyQualifierId(String id)
     23       {
     24          super(id);
     25       }
     26 
     27    public static final PolicyQualifierId id_qt_cps =
     28        new PolicyQualifierId(id_qt + ".1");
     29    public static final PolicyQualifierId id_qt_unotice =
     30        new PolicyQualifierId(id_qt + ".2");
     31 }
     32